WTF? Seriously? We all talk about collectability, but this is ridiculous. So I guess if you can afford to put one away....do it??


Black on Black
  • 32 miles
  • Protective plastic still affixed to driver's seat
  • Window sticker and inspection sheets
  • Finished in Pitch Black with Black interior
  • Redeye Widebody, $17,000 option
  • Supercharged 6.2L/797 HP V-8 engine
  • SRT Power Chiller
  • Torqueflite 8-speed automatic transmission
  • Steering wheel-mounted shift control
  • Widebody Competition suspension
  • Launch control and launch assist
  • Line lock
  • Widebody fender flares
  • 3.09 rear axle ratio
  • Brembo disc brakes
  • Laguna leather package
  • Red seatbelts
  • Plus Package with ventilated front seats, power tilt and telescopic column, suede door trim and map pocket and dark engine-turned interior accents
  • Driver Convenience Group including blind spot and rear cross path detection, HID headlamps and multi-function mirrors
  • Harman Kardon Audio Group with subwoofer and GreenEdge amplifier
  • Black hood pin kit
  • SRT Performance spoiler
  • 20x11 Devil's Rim forged aluminum wheels
  • 305/35ZR20 all season performance tires

Just wait until they are gone in a couple years, that's when the real escalation will begin. My friends who once called vintage Cuda's Challengers and Chargers dime-A-dozen used cars in the 70s/80s, now call today's Challenger the same (and they are wrong both times). Despite that I still don't think its worth the aggravation to keep a car solely as an investment though, due to how long it takes them to ramp up to a substantial gain. I do it because I enjoy owning them and like keeping them nice, yet ironically I have never spent a dime on cars (net overall cost) in my entire life while having a lot of fun. It's like having a no expense hobby if you own the right cars for the right reasons.
